FoilSim is an interactive
simulation software package that examines the airflow around various shapes
of airfoils. As you change the parameters of airspeed. altitude, angle
of attack, thickness, curvature of the airfoil, and area of the wing,
the software calculates lift. The package was created at the NASA Glenn
Research Center to illustrate an example of the research being done there.
